The hard palate is involved in the articulation of which type of consonants?ALabialBVelarCPalatalDUvularAnswer: C. Palatal Read Explanation: The hard palate is involved in the articulation of palatal consonants and some postalveolar consonants.Types of Consonants Articulated at the Hard Palate:Palatal Consonants:These sounds are produced when the tongue body (dorsum) touches or approaches the hard palate.Examples in IPA: /j/ (as in yes).Postalveolar Consonants:Some postalveolar sounds are articulated near the hard palate, with the tongue blade touching just behind the alveolar ridge.Examples in IPA: /ʃ, ʒ, tʃ, dʒ/ (as in she, vision, chin, judge).
